WISE, VA. – RJ Wilson's three-pointer with just under a minute to go gave the Chowan Men's Basketball team enough distance to fight off the Cavaliers of UVA Wise in non-conference action on Monday afternoon.
THE BASICS
FINAL | Chowan 79, UVA Wise 76
RECORDS | Chowan 6-5, UVA Wise 6-5
LOCATION | Wise, Va. (Prior Convocation Center)
INSIDE THE BOXSCORE
Daylan Askew led the Hawks with 20 points and nine rebounds, scoring 14 points in the second half. RJ Wilson added 15 points and nine rebounds.
Damerius Summers added 10 points off the bench.
Chowan trailed 9-0 early before ending the half on a 22-9 run to lead 36-28 at the intermission. The Hawks would build their lead to 16, 46-30, with 16:13 remaining before UVA Wise regained the lead, 71-69, with 2:24 remaining.
RJ Wilson knocked down a three-pointer with 59 seconds remaining to give the Hawks a 77-74 lead. Wilson's triple was the difference in the contest.
